Abstract

An aerosol source for a vapor provision system includes a vapor generating element; a reservoir for holding source liquid, the reservoir being bounded by a wall having an opening therein; and a liquid transport element for delivering liquid from the reservoir to the vapor generating element, the liquid transport element having at least one end part inserted into the opening, the end part having a flared portion arranged in contact with the wall of the reservoir to provide a seal for the opening.

Claims (26)

1. An aerosol source for a vapor provision system comprising:

a vapor generating element;

a reservoir for holding source liquid, the reservoir being bounded by a wall having an opening therein; and

a liquid transport element for delivering the source liquid from the reservoir to the vapor generating element, the liquid transport element having at least one end part inserted into the opening, the at least one end part having a flared portion arranged in contact with the wall of the reservoir to provide a seal for the opening;

wherein the flared portion is held in contact with a surface of the wall that forms a bore of the opening.

2. The aerosol source according to claim 1 , wherein the flared portion is in contact with an inner surface of the wall of the reservoir peripheral to the opening.

3. The aerosol source according to claim 2 , further comprising one or more compression members positioned in an interior of the reservoir to press the flared portion against the inner surface of the wall.

4. The aerosol source according to claim 3 , wherein the one or more compression members is shaped to press the flared portion against the inner surface of the wall around a complete perimeter of the opening.

5. The aerosol source according to claim 3 , wherein the one or more compression members presses the flared portion against the inner surface of the wall at one or more locations spaced apart from an edge of the opening.

6. The aerosol source according to claim 1 , further comprising a plugging element penetrating the at least one end part of the liquid transport element along an axis substantially parallel to a longitudinal axis of the bore of the opening so as to press the flared portion against the surface of the wall forming the bore of the opening.

7. The aerosol source according to claim 6 , wherein the plugging element comprises a tube through which the source liquid in the reservoir can pass for absorption by the liquid transport element.

8. The aerosol source according to claim 6 , wherein the plugging element comprises a solid plug.

9. The aerosol source according to claim 1 , further comprising a ring positioned coaxially within the bore of the opening, the flared portion being arranged between the ring and the surface of the wall forming the bore of the opening so as to be pressed against the surface of the wall forming the bore of the opening by the ring.

10. The aerosol source according to claim 9 , wherein the liquid transport element extends through the ring, and the flared portion is arranged between the ring and the surface of the wall forming the bore of the opening by curving back over the ring.

11. The aerosol source according to claim 9 , wherein the ring is placed inside the flared portion such that the source liquid in the reservoir can pass through the ring for absorption by the liquid transport element.

12. The aerosol source according to claim 1 , wherein the liquid transport element is formed from fibers, and the flared portion is formed by outward splaying of the fibers.

13. The aerosol source according to claim 1 , wherein the liquid transport element and the flared portion are formed by molding or machining of a material into an intended shape.

14. The aerosol source according to claim 1 , wherein the reservoir has two openings, and the liquid transport element has two end parts each with a flared portion, each of the two end parts being inserted into one of the two openings.

15. A vaporizer for a vapor provision system comprising:

a vapor generating element for generating vapor from a liquid; and

a liquid transport element for delivering the liquid from a reservoir to the vapor generating element, the liquid transport element having at least one end part inserted into an opening in a wall of the reservoir, the at least one end part having a flared portion arranged in contact with the wall of the reservoir to provide a seal for the opening.

16. A liquid transport element for a vapor provision system, comprising:

a reservoir for holding source liquid, the reservoir including a wall having an opening; and

at least one end part insert into the opening, the at least one end part having a flared portion arranged in contact with the wall of the reservoir to provide a seal for the opening.

17. A cartomizer for a vapor provision system comprising the aerosol source according to claim 1 .

18. A vapor provision system comprising the aerosol source according to claim 1 .
